Course details
Smart Contracts: Building the Foundation of Blockchain for Personal Finance Security This unit introduces the concept of smart contracts, self-executing contracts with the terms of the agreement written directly into lines of code. It explains how smart contracts can be used to automate various financial processes, ensuring security, transparency, and efficiency in personal finance. •
Blockchain Architecture: Understanding the Components of a Secure Blockchain Network This unit delves into the architecture of a blockchain network, including the roles of nodes, miners, and consensus algorithms. It discusses the importance of a secure blockchain architecture in personal finance, including the use of decentralized networks and cryptographic techniques. •
Cryptocurrencies and Digital Assets: Understanding the Risks and Opportunities This unit explores the world of cryptocurrencies and digital assets, including their uses, risks, and opportunities. It discusses the role of blockchain technology in the creation and management of these assets, and how they can be used to enhance personal finance security. •
Blockchain Security: Threats, Mitigation Strategies, and Best Practices This unit focuses on the security aspects of blockchain technology, including common threats, mitigation strategies, and best practices. It discusses the importance of secure key management, secure communication protocols, and secure network architecture in personal finance. •
Regulatory Frameworks for Blockchain and Cryptocurrencies This unit examines the regulatory frameworks surrounding blockchain and cryptocurrencies, including government regulations, industry standards, and international cooperation. It discusses the implications of these frameworks for personal finance security and the use of blockchain technology. •
Blockchain for Supply Chain Management: Enhancing Transparency and Efficiency This unit explores the use of blockchain technology in supply chain management, including its potential to enhance transparency, efficiency, and security. It discusses the benefits of using blockchain in personal finance, including reduced counterfeiting, improved tracking, and enhanced customer trust. •
Blockchain for Identity Verification: Secure Authentication and Authorization This unit discusses the use of blockchain technology in identity verification, including secure authentication and authorization protocols. It explores the benefits of using blockchain in personal finance, including enhanced security, improved trust, and reduced identity theft. •
Blockchain for Anti-Money Laundering (AML) and Know-Your-Customer (KYC) This unit examines the use of blockchain technology in AML and KYC, including its potential to enhance transparency, efficiency, and security. It discusses the benefits of using blockchain in personal finance, including reduced risk of money laundering, improved compliance, and enhanced customer due diligence. •
Blockchain for Personal Finance: Use Cases and Applications This unit explores the various use cases and applications of blockchain technology in personal finance, including digital wallets, payment systems, and investment platforms. It discusses the benefits of using blockchain in personal finance, including enhanced security, improved efficiency, and reduced costs. •
Blockchain Development: Building a Secure and Scalable Blockchain Network This unit provides an overview of blockchain development, including the tools, technologies, and best practices required to build a secure and scalable blockchain network. It discusses the importance of secure development, including secure coding practices, secure testing, and secure deployment.
